This is a miniature portrait of Mrs. Carter of Edgecote, created by Anne Mee. The composition of this small work is striking in its simplicity. Mee uses delicate brushwork and subtle gradations of color to capture the likeness of Mrs. Carter. The soft pastel hues of the background—a gentle blue that fades into white—create an ethereal quality, emphasizing the sitter's serene expression. The details, though minute, are meticulously rendered, from the delicate pearls adorning her neck to the intricate folds of her white dress. The overall effect is one of understated elegance and refinement, a visual manifestation of the sitter's social standing and personal grace. Mee’s attention to detail also serves to highlight the material qualities inherent in the painting. The texture of the paper, the luminosity of the pigments, and the delicate handling of the brush all contribute to the artwork's aesthetic power. The oval shape of the portrait further accentuates its intimacy, inviting the viewer to engage with the sitter on a personal level. It is a testament to Mee’s skill that she could create such a compelling and evocative image within such a limited format.
